1. Data-Driven Insights Driving Decision-Making
Digital marketing channels provide valuable insights into consumer behaviour, preferences, and market trends. By analyzing this data, supply chain managers can gain a deeper understanding of demand patterns and adjust production and inventory levels accordingly. This data-driven approach helps minimize stockouts, reduce excess inventory, and improve forecasting accuracy, ultimately leading to cost savings and enhanced supply chain efficiency.
2. Personalized Marketing and Customized Supply Chains
In today’s era of personalized marketing, customers expect tailored experiences and products that meet their unique needs and preferences. Digital marketing enables businesses to collect and analyze customer data to deliver targeted campaigns and personalized promotions. Similarly, supply chain management can leverage this data to create customized supply chain solutions, such as direct-to-consumer fulfillment models or configure-to-order manufacturing processes. By aligning marketing efforts with supply chain capabilities, companies can deliver a seamless and personalized experience from product discovery to delivery.
3. Omnichannel Integration for Seamless Customer Journeys
The rise of omnichannel retailing has blurred the lines between online and offline shopping experiences. Customers expect a seamless and consistent experience across all touchpoints, whether they are browsing products online, visiting a physical store, or interacting with a brand on social media. Digital marketing plays a crucial role in driving omnichannel engagement, while supply chain management ensures efficient order fulfillment and delivery across multiple channels. By integrating digital marketing initiatives with supply chain operations, companies can streamline inventory management, optimize order fulfillment processes, and provide real-time visibility into product availability, thus enhancing the overall customer journey.
4. Agile Supply Chain Strategies in Response to Market Dynamics
In today’s dynamic business environment, agility is key to staying responsive to changing market conditions and consumer demands. Digital marketing provides real-time feedback on campaign performance and customer engagement, allowing companies to quickly adapt marketing strategies and promotional offers. Similarly, supply chain management can adopt agile practices, such as just-in-time manufacturing and dynamic routing optimization, to respond rapidly to fluctuations in demand or disruptions in the supply chain. By aligning digital marketing efforts with agile supply chain strategies, companies can maintain flexibility and resilience in the face of uncertainty, ensuring continuity and customer satisfaction.
5. Sustainability and Ethical Sourcing Practices
Increasingly, consumers are demanding transparency and accountability from brands regarding their environmental and social impact. Digital marketing can be a powerful tool for communicating sustainability initiatives and ethical sourcing practices to consumers, building trust and loyalty. Supply chain management plays a critical role in implementing sustainable practices, such as eco-friendly packaging, carbon-neutral transportation, and ethical sourcing of raw materials. By integrating sustainability into both digital marketing campaigns and supply chain operations, companies can demonstrate their commitment to corporate social responsibility and attract environmentally conscious consumers.
